Atụmatụ
- 4WD Brushless Motor & ESC: Equipped with a powerful 4WD brushless motor and Electronic Speed Controller for superior off-road performance.
- High Ground Clearance: Boasts a substantial 27mm ground clearance, enabling it to tackle rugged terrains.
- Ihe na-adịgide adịgide: Constructed with a robust PVC car shell and PA+fiber roll cage for durability.
- Advanced Steering Servo: Features a responsive 9G 3-wire servo for precise steering control.
- Integrated 2.4GHz 4CH Remote Control: Comes with a 2.4GHz 4CH remote for reliable and responsive control up to 100m.
- 3-Nfefe Ọsọ: Mechanical shift gearbox with low-speed gears for high torque climbing and high-speed gears for faster movement.
- 4-Wheel Steering Modes: Offers multiple steering modes for enhanced maneuverability.

Melite
1. Ntinye na Nchaji Batrị
The UCX2405PRO uses a 1 AA battery (included) for the remote control and a rechargeable battery for the car. Ensure both are charged before first use. The car's battery is typically accessed by removing the body pins and lifting the body shell.

2. Controller Setup & Binding
Insert the AA battery into the remote control. Turn on the remote and then the RC car. The remote and car should automatically bind. Refer to the remote control's specific instructions for detailed binding procedures if needed.
3. Nyocha mbụ
Before first use, inspect all components for any visible damage. Ensure all wheels are securely attached and the suspension moves freely. Check that all wires are connected properly.

Nlekọta
- Nhicha: After each use, especially in dusty or dirty conditions, clean the car to remove debris. Use a soft brush or compressed air.
- Nyocha: Regularly check for loose screws, damaged parts, or worn tires. Replace any damaged components promptly.
- mmanu mmanu: Periodically lubricate moving parts as recommended in the full product manual (if available) to ensure smooth operation.
